What Is an AI Music Tool?

An AI music tool is software that uses machine learning to generate original music, assist with composition, suggest chord progressions, or even master your tracks. These tools are trained on massive datasets of music across genres, instruments, and styles.

They’re used to automate beat creation, compose orchestral scores, generate lyrics, remix tracks, and much more. Whether you’re building a chill lo-fi beat or a cinematic score, AI tools reduce the technical barrier while expanding your musical possibilities.

AIVA (Artificial Intelligence Virtual Artist)

AIVA is one of the most advanced AI composers, capable of generating powerful orchestral pieces inspired by legendary composers like Beethoven and Mozart. It’s a favorite among filmmakers, game developers, and advertisers who need emotionally-driven background scores.

The interface lets you choose a style, tempo, and edit the arrangement in a digital sheet. Whether you’re producing a fantasy soundtrack or a brand anthem, AIVA’s cinematic capabilities make it a professional-grade choice.

Soundraw

Soundraw lets users choose mood, genre, and length to instantly generate royalty-free tracks. Unlike one-click generators, it offers detailed editing options to modify tempo, instruments, and intensity.

Ideal for YouTubers and video creators, Soundraw strikes a balance between AI automation and manual control. You get flexibility without needing to compose from scratch.

Amper Music (Shutterstock)

Amper offers customizable background music for business videos, ads, and explainer content. Select genre, mood, and instruments—Amper does the rest, producing polished, royalty-free tracks within minutes.

Its simplicity makes it ideal for marketers and non-musicians. You can fine-tune audio length and dynamics to align with your brand’s voice.

Ecrett Music

Ecrett stands out for generating music based on scene types—like cooking, travel, or action—along with emotional tones and genres. It’s perfect for creators posting frequent video content on TikTok, Instagram, or YouTube.

Its easy UI lets you create custom music in under a minute, and all tracks are royalty-free. No musical knowledge required—just click and create.

Endel

Endel generates personalized soundscapes for focus, relaxation, and sleep. It adjusts in real time using data like time of day, weather, and heart rate to match your environment.

Used by wellness creators and ambient sound designers, it’s ideal for producing adaptive soundtracks in meditation, therapy, or wellness apps.

LANDR

LANDR is a complete production suite featuring AI-powered mastering, music distribution, and beat generation. Trusted by millions of artists, it covers the full pipeline from sound creation to release.

LANDR’s AI mastering is especially praised for matching professional studio quality. It also helps monetize music across Spotify, Apple Music, and more.

Boomy

Boomy lets anyone create songs in seconds—just pick a mood, and the AI generates a complete track with vocals. You can edit, export, and even publish it to streaming platforms.

Its focus on monetization makes it unique. Users can earn royalties on tracks they release via Boomy, making it popular with beginners looking to become creators.

Beatoven.ai

Beatoven.ai produces adaptive background music by analyzing the mood flow of your video content. It adjusts energy levels to match scene transitions for a cohesive viewing experience.

Video editors and indie filmmakers use it to bring emotional consistency to visual storytelling. It’s an intuitive solution for anyone editing narrative content.

BandLab SongStarter

SongStarter gives you AI-powered prompts and chord ideas to kick off your songwriting journey. It’s ideal for getting past writer’s block and testing new ideas.

It integrates well with BandLab’s full DAW suite. For hobbyists and casual songwriters, it’s a fun and motivating way to build complete tracks.

OpenAI Jukebox

OpenAI Jukebox is a research-level tool that generates music in the style of known artists—including lyrics and vocals. It creates genre-blending tracks that push the boundaries of music AI.

While not production-ready, it showcases what’s possible with deep learning and is a must-try for tech-savvy musicians or experimental creators.

Mubert

Mubert offers endless AI-generated music streams categorized by genre, mood, and activity. You can license these loops for podcasts, SaaS apps, or livestreams.

With its API and playlist generator, Mubert is great for developers or creators needing continuous, adaptive background music without licensing issues.

Soundful

Soundful lets creators generate, customize, and monetize AI-generated music. You can control tempo, key, genre, and instrumentation with royalty-free ownership.

Its commercial-use license makes it perfect for freelancers, brands, and digital agencies looking for original soundtracks.

Audionautix

Audionautix offers AI-assisted music under Creative Commons licenses. It’s free to use and doesn’t require login or payments—just download and go.

Perfect for podcasters, hobbyists, and students creating audio content on a budget.

Lovo Studio

Lovo, known for AI voiceovers, now includes music generation within its platform. Combine narration and AI music for seamless multimedia experiences.

It’s especially valuable for e-learning, audiobooks, and podcast creators who want to build layered audio without outsourcing.

WaveAI

WaveAI focuses on co-creation by offering lyric suggestions, melody builders, and harmonic ideas to enhance songwriting. Its tools aim to complement—not replace—your voice.

Singer-songwriters love its balance of control and inspiration. It speeds up the creative process while preserving artistic intent.

Riffusion

Riffusion creates music using image diffusion models. You build a visual representation of sound, and the AI converts it into loops and melodies.

It’s experimental and artistic—great for sound designers and musicians exploring unconventional forms of composition.

Hobnox Audiotool

Audiotool is a virtual music studio with synths, samplers, and drum machines—recently updated with AI-powered sequencing and sound presets.

If you love the DIY ethos of music production but want some automation, Audiotool blends both worlds beautifully.

Popgun

Popgun’s AI musician “Alice” helps you co-compose in real time, reacting to your input like a bandmate would. It can improvise and even sing.

It’s one of the most advanced attempts at live AI collaboration and is ideal for experimental and real-time performance artists.

Splice Studio + AI

Splice includes AI tools that recommend samples, auto-arrange beats, and generate chord progressions based on your genre.

With its huge sample library and producer community, it’s a full creative ecosystem for musicians who want speed with pro quality.

Voicemod Studio

Voicemod enhances real-time vocals with AI filters, musical effects, and voice transformation for creators and streamers.

It’s not a music composer per se, but adds flair to live audio content—perfect for gaming streams, voiceovers, and short-form musical content.
